Fernandez's crash at the beginning of FP2 forced him to sit out the entire weekend, including qualifying. As a result, the starting grid remains unchanged from the order established in Q1 and Q2. Marco Bezzecchi secures pole position, leading the charge ahead of Pedro Acosta and Fabio Quartararo, who will be eager to capitalize on this opportunity. Francesco Bagnaia heads the second row, joined by Alex Marquez, whose strong pace on Friday marked him as a pre-race favorite despite a late Q2 crash at turn three. Johann Zarco completes the row, adding another layer of intrigue to the mix. Joan Mir starts seventh, flanked by Jack Miller and Fabio Di Giannantonio on the third row, while Pol Espargaro leads the fourth row alongside Fermin Aldeguer and Ai Ogura.

For Nicolo Bulega, the Sprint marks his first MotoGP race start, albeit from 18th position after a costly mistake at turn 11 in Q1.
